Verhalten bei gleichzeit mehreren Tasten-Eingaben

Dies ist das deutsche Forum für alle Themen um den KeyWarrior. Beiträge bitte nur in Deutsch.

Moderator: Guido Körber

Post Reply
ploenne
Posts: 8
Joined: Fri Mar 09, 2007 1:33 pm

Verhalten bei gleichzeit mehreren Tasten-Eingaben

Post by ploenne »

Wertes Forum

Aufgrund von Problemen mit anderen HID-Keyboard Emulatoren habe ich folgende Frage :

Wie verhält sich den der Keywarrior bei gleichzeitigem Drücken von mehreren Tasten ? Wann kommen OFF Events zu den jeweiligen Tastendrücken.

Ist das Verhalten wie folgt : ?

1. Taste A wird gedrückt. ... Key A ON Event
2. Danach wird Taste B gedrückt ... Key B ON Event
3. Taste B wird losgelassen Key B OFF Event
4. Taste A wird losgelassen Key A OFF Event

In der englischen Teil des Keywarrior Forums wurde (allerdings schon 2008) geschrieben, das man den Keywarrior problemlos (wenn es nur um USB Anbindung geht) auch im DevBoard des IOWarrior40 betreiben kann, gilt das noch und wenn ja welche Version des Keywarriors kann man so benutzen ?

mfg ploenne



mfg ploenne
Guido Körber
Site Admin
Posts: 2856
Joined: Tue Nov 25, 2003 10:25 pm
Location: Germany/Berlin
Contact:

Re: Verhalten bei gleichzeit mehreren Tasten-Eingaben

Post by Guido Körber »

Die Events werden in der Reihenfolge gesendet wie sie auftreten. Wenn wirklich mal zwei Tasten tatsächlich gleichzeitig ihren Status ändern, dann wird die mit der höheren Y/X Nummer zuerst gesendet.

Die KeyWarrior8xx-MOD und KeyWarrior16xx-MOD passen prinzipiell auf den Sockel des IOW40KIT.
ploenne
Posts: 8
Joined: Fri Mar 09, 2007 1:33 pm

Re: Verhalten bei gleichzeit mehreren Tasten-Eingaben

Post by ploenne »

Vielleicht habe ich die Frage mit 'gleichzeitig' etwas falsch gestellt.

1. Taste A wird gedrückt. ... Key A ON Event
2. Zeitlich später wird Taste B gedrückt ... Key B ON Event (Taste A wird weiterhin gehalten)
3. Taste B wird losgelassen Key B OFF Event
4. Taste A wird losgelassen Key A OFF Event

Reagiert der Keywarrior so ? Wichtig wäre die Reihenfolge der Events. Wir haben hier einen anderen Treiberstein welcher an Position 2 (in der List oben) uns erstmal ein Key A OFF Event sendet, obwohl Taste A noch gehalten wird, und was natürlich falsch ist.
Guido Körber
Site Admin
Posts: 2856
Joined: Tue Nov 25, 2003 10:25 pm
Location: Germany/Berlin
Contact:

Re: Verhalten bei gleichzeit mehreren Tasten-Eingaben

Post by Guido Körber »

Also kurz formuliert: Der KeyWarrior verhält sich korrekt. Die Tastenevents werden in der Reihenfolge gesendet wie sie auftreten. Nur wenn Macros mit ins Spiel kommen und dann mehrere Tasten gleichzeitig gedrückt sind, von denen mindestens eine ein Macro erzeugt, kann es kompliziert werden.
Post Reply